So just closing the loop here and reconciling threads from #1045, since the PR only changes what the snippet flow writes when a user newly invokes "Add Configuration" and what the dynamic provider suggests in-memory for users without a launch.json, anyone with module: uvicorn already in their launch.json keeps that exact config and continues to work. I've also added tiered auto-detection so monorepo/nested layouts don't break out of the box: Auto-detection (applied in both flows):
The snippet flow also prompts on 0 matches (with no pre-fill). The dynamic provider doesn't surface FastAPI configs at all if 0 are detected. |

Copilot generated:
Unresolved from prior review (Medium): path.relative emits OS-native separators, so a single subdir match persists "args": ["run", "backend\\app\\main.py"] on Windows. A launch.json shared to macOS/Linux then runs fastapi run backend\app\main.py, which treats backslashes literally and fails despite correct detection. The Skeptic notes the central fix actually broadened exposure here (root single-matches previously emitted separator-free ['run']). Normalize to POSIX in the persisted arg (e.g. relative.split(path.sep).join('/')) and confirm fastapi run accepts forward slashes on Windows.

A draft for #1045 - opening this to make the proposed approach a bit more concrete. Happy to adjust based on the open discussion before marking it review ready (there are some open questions to align on in the issue).
This updates the FastAPI debug configuration (both the
launch.jsonsnippet and the dynamic provider) to use thefastapiCLI instead of invokinguvicorndirectly:Debug FastAPI with current file - runs
fastapi run ${file}against the currently active file. This is optimal for single-file apps or quickly debugging a specific entry point.Debug FastAPI - runs plain
fastapi runand lets the CLI discover the app viapyproject.tomlor default file locations.This replaces the previous
uvicorn main:app --reloadconfig and its hand-rolledmain.pydetection.I have run the tests and manually tested as well.
